WebA 47-year-old man presented with a tender soft tissue mass on the upper back with increasing discomfort over the last 4 weeks. He noted that he felt feverish a few times. Physical examination revealed a 3×4-cm area of induration involving the upper mid back with faint erythema of the overlying skin; no drainage was noted. WebApr 10, 2024 · The long axes of the two flaps (D1 and D2) formed an obtuse angle. The lengths of D1 and D2 were the same and equal to the length of the soft tissue defect, which should be no more than 8 cm, usually 6 cm. WebMay 10, 2013 · Structure. The soft tissue envelope of the cranial vault is called the scalp. The scalp extends from the external occipital protuberance and superior nuchal lines to the supraorbital margins.
